Method 1:
- Startup your server.
 - Click "Web Console"
 - Use this command: 
SetAccessLevel <username> <level>Making sure to replace<username>with your in-game name and<level>with one of the admin levels below.
Admin Levels:Observer:
- Toggle god mod (on himself only)
 - Toggle invisible (on himself only)
 - See players connected (/players)
 - Teleport to a player (can't teleport a player elsewhere)
 - Can toggle noclip (on himself only)
 - Teleport to coordinates
 - See server options
 - Can open locked doors
 - Can go inside safehouses
 - Can't be kicked if too laggy
 - Can always join server (even if full)
 - Can talk even being invisible
 - Sees invisible players
 - Can't be hit by players
 - Log directly invisible/invincible
 - Can see players stats (name, skill, traits...) with click on player -> Check Stats (but can't modify them)
 
GM:- Everything an Observer can use, plus:
 - Toggle god mod (on himself and others)
 - Toggle invisible (on himself and others)
 - Can toggle noclip (on himself and others)
 - Teleport to a player to another player
 - Use /alarm, /gunshot, /thunder and /chopper
 - Start/Stop rain
 - Add item
 - Add xp
 
Overseer:- Everything a GM can use, plus:
 - Create horde
 - Kick user
 - Display server message
 - See connection info of a player
 - Disconnect a player by connection number (/disconnect)
 - Use /nightlengthmodifier
 - Can modify player stats in the player stats UI
 - Can ban a player from /all chat
 
Moderator:- Everything an Overseer can use, plus:
 - Ban/Unban user (including steam ID)
 - Manipulate whitelist (/adduser, /addusertowhitelist, /addalltowhitelist, /removeuserfromwhitelist
 - Change access level (can't set admin)
 - Can setup safehouses
 
Admin:- Everything a Moderator can use, plus:
 - Save world
 - Quit world
 - Change access level (including admin)
 - Reload server options
 - Change server options
 - Send pulse
 - Reload Lua files
 - Bypass Lua checksum
 
 
Method 2:
- Click "Commandline Manager"
 - Click "Selected" on the current commandline to edit it, then change the admin password if you desire and make note of it
 - Log into the server with the username "admin" and the admin password you set in the commandline, as well as the other server details. As shown below:
